Definition, Betydelse, Synonymer & Anagram | Engelska ordet DOWEL


DOWEL

Definition av DOWEL

  1. dymling; pinne på tvären som skarvar ihop liggande timmer
  2. centrumtapp; pinne som limmas i hål
  3. skruvplugg
